Psychiatric services complicated by communication factor 90785
Psychiatric services complicated by communication factors involve mental health care for individuals who have challenges with communication. This can include language barriers, speech disorders, or cognitive impairments. The process involves tailored strategies to ensure effective communication and appropriate mental health care.

Psychiatric diagnostic evaluation with medical services 90792
A psychiatric diagnostic evaluation with medical services is a comprehensive assessment. It includes a detailed examination of your mental health and physical wellbeing, as well as your personal and family history. This evaluation aids in creating an effective treatment plan.
